999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

21鍵數(shù)顯音符的電子琴設(shè)計(jì)

2022-12-01 05:29:16李健陳銀
電子制作 2022年20期
關(guān)鍵詞:單片機(jī)系統(tǒng)

李健,陳銀

(巢湖學(xué)院 電子工程學(xué)院,安徽合肥,238000)

0 引言

隨著我國(guó)經(jīng)濟(jì)快速發(fā)展,人民的生活質(zhì)量逐步提高,娛樂(lè)產(chǎn)品走入千家萬(wàn)戶。電子琴等電子產(chǎn)品的誕生,豐富了業(yè)余生活,讓人民的生活多姿多彩[1]。電子琴是現(xiàn)代電子技術(shù)應(yīng)用于音樂(lè)而制作的電子樂(lè)器[2]。單片機(jī)高具有強(qiáng)大的控制及邏輯運(yùn)算功能,以單片機(jī)為核心的電器設(shè)備已融入人們的日常生活中,如電視機(jī)、電冰箱、洗衣機(jī)、DVD、汽車音響等[2]。本文利用一款性價(jià)比高的單片機(jī)STC89C52作為核心控制器,設(shè)計(jì)制作一種帶有21鍵,且能顯示音符、指示高中低音的電子琴。該電子琴系統(tǒng)具有電路結(jié)構(gòu)簡(jiǎn)單、音符種類較多、易操作、成本低等優(yōu)點(diǎn),可以作為低齡兒童培養(yǎng)音樂(lè)興趣的玩具來(lái)用。

1 系統(tǒng)方案

電子琴整體方案框圖如圖1所示,系統(tǒng)以STC89C52單片機(jī)為核心,外圍配置了3×7矩陣鍵盤電路、數(shù)碼管音符顯示電路、LED高中低音指示電路和揚(yáng)聲器發(fā)聲電路等,主要工作流程為:有按鍵按下,單片機(jī)識(shí)別后通過(guò)揚(yáng)聲器發(fā)出與該按鍵對(duì)應(yīng)的音符的聲音,同時(shí)有一個(gè)數(shù)碼管顯示當(dāng)前音符,還有對(duì)應(yīng)的LED指示當(dāng)前發(fā)出的是高音、中音還是低音。

系統(tǒng)設(shè)計(jì)過(guò)程采用了Proteus軟件繪制仿真電路,采用Keil軟件編寫代碼,在計(jì)算機(jī)上仿真通過(guò)后,再設(shè)計(jì)制作了實(shí)物電路加以調(diào)試驗(yàn)證。

2 系統(tǒng)硬件設(shè)計(jì)

2.1 單片機(jī)最小系統(tǒng)

系統(tǒng)采用了性價(jià)比高的單片機(jī)STC89C52作為核心控制器,圖2為單片機(jī)最小系統(tǒng)組成,是單片機(jī)正常工作需要配置的,包括晶體振蕩器構(gòu)成的時(shí)鐘電路、按鍵復(fù)位電路,還有P0口接了上拉排阻,此外還要提供電源,但Proteus軟件中單片機(jī)默認(rèn)供給了電源,所以圖中無(wú)需畫出(圖中選用的AT89C51單片機(jī)與實(shí)際采用的STC89C52是兼容的)。

2.2 按鍵電路

電子琴必然少不了按鍵電路,按鍵用于彈奏出各種不同的音調(diào)。本系統(tǒng)中設(shè)計(jì)了3×7的矩陣鍵盤電路,如圖3所示,第一行7個(gè)按鍵代表低音的do~si,第二行7個(gè)按鍵代表中音的do~si,第三行7個(gè)按鍵代表高音的do~si。

矩陣鍵盤的三行分別接至單片機(jī)的P2.5~P2.7引腳,七列分別接至單片機(jī)的P1.0~P1.6引腳。

2.3 音符顯示與音調(diào)高低指示電路

音符顯示與音調(diào)高低指示電路如圖4所示,當(dāng)某個(gè)按鍵按下時(shí),通過(guò)一個(gè)共陽(yáng)型數(shù)碼管顯示對(duì)應(yīng)的音調(diào)符號(hào),上電顯示0,當(dāng)按鍵按下時(shí),顯示的1~7分別對(duì)應(yīng)音調(diào)的do~si。同時(shí)為了顯示音調(diào)的高低,采用三個(gè)不同顏色的LED進(jìn)行指示,綠色代表低音,藍(lán)色代表中音,紅色代表高音。

七段數(shù)碼管按順序接至單片機(jī)的P0.0~P0.6,三個(gè)LED接至P3.0、P3.4和P3.5。

2.4 揚(yáng)聲器發(fā)聲電路

按鍵按下后,單片機(jī)通過(guò)控制三極管通斷,驅(qū)動(dòng)揚(yáng)聲器發(fā)出對(duì)應(yīng)的音調(diào),如圖5所示,NPN三極管的基極接至單片機(jī)的P3.7引腳。

2.5 系統(tǒng)整體電路

設(shè)計(jì)好各個(gè)模塊電路后,將之組合成的整個(gè)電子琴系統(tǒng)的仿真電路如圖6所示。

3 系統(tǒng)程序設(shè)計(jì)

本系統(tǒng)所需的程序采用C語(yǔ)言在Keil軟件中編程實(shí)現(xiàn)。系統(tǒng)產(chǎn)生不同音調(diào)的原理是:?jiǎn)纹瑱C(jī)在12 MHz的時(shí)鐘頻率下工作,利用它的定時(shí)器T0中斷、工作方式1(16位定時(shí)器工作模式),通過(guò)改變定時(shí)器TH0、TL0的計(jì)數(shù)初值,產(chǎn)生不同頻率的脈沖信號(hào)來(lái)模擬實(shí)際各種不同的音調(diào),各種音符音調(diào)的頻率和計(jì)數(shù)初值如表1所示。

表1 各種音符的頻率及其對(duì)應(yīng)的定時(shí)初值

系統(tǒng)程序主要包括按鍵的識(shí)別、定時(shí)器初值的修改和定時(shí)、數(shù)碼管音符數(shù)字的顯示和LED的亮滅、利用定時(shí)器產(chǎn)生的不同頻率的脈沖控制三極管通斷來(lái)驅(qū)動(dòng)揚(yáng)聲器發(fā)出不同頻率的聲音等幾部分。系統(tǒng)程序流程圖如圖7所示。

4 電路仿真與實(shí)物制作

4.1 電路仿真

按照前面的電路設(shè)計(jì),在Proteus軟件中搭建好仿真電路,且編寫好代碼后運(yùn)行,經(jīng)過(guò)反復(fù)調(diào)試得到正確的結(jié)果如圖8所示:按下低音3(mi)鍵,數(shù)碼管顯示數(shù)字3,低音的綠色LED點(diǎn)亮,同時(shí)揚(yáng)聲器發(fā)出對(duì)應(yīng)的聲音。

4.2 實(shí)際電路制作

系統(tǒng)仿真通過(guò)后,在此基礎(chǔ)上設(shè)計(jì)實(shí)際的電路原理圖如圖9所示,與仿真電路基本一致,部分位置做了一定的修改以達(dá)到更好的效果;再焊接制作實(shí)際電路,并經(jīng)過(guò)調(diào)試得到運(yùn)行后的實(shí)物如圖10所示(圖中按鍵3按下后已松手,數(shù)碼管顯示的數(shù)字不變,但音調(diào)指示LED不再亮,同時(shí)停止發(fā)出聲音)。

5 總結(jié)

本文介紹了一款帶有21個(gè)按鍵,以數(shù)碼管顯示音符、LED指示音調(diào)高低,通過(guò)揚(yáng)聲器發(fā)出常規(guī)樂(lè)曲聲音的電子琴設(shè)計(jì)過(guò)程,其以51單片機(jī)為核心,整體電路結(jié)構(gòu)簡(jiǎn)單、功能較為齊全、性價(jià)比高,經(jīng)過(guò)軟硬件設(shè)計(jì)和反復(fù)調(diào)試,最終實(shí)現(xiàn)了預(yù)期的效果,能彈奏出各種音調(diào)的聲音。

猜你喜歡
單片機(jī)系統(tǒng)
Smartflower POP 一體式光伏系統(tǒng)
WJ-700無(wú)人機(jī)系統(tǒng)
ZC系列無(wú)人機(jī)遙感系統(tǒng)
基于單片機(jī)的SPWM控制逆變器的設(shè)計(jì)與實(shí)現(xiàn)
電子制作(2019年13期)2020-01-14 03:15:28
基于PowerPC+FPGA顯示系統(tǒng)
基于單片機(jī)的層次漸變暖燈的研究
電子制作(2019年15期)2019-08-27 01:12:10
基于單片機(jī)的便捷式LCF測(cè)量?jī)x
電子制作(2019年9期)2019-05-30 09:42:02
半沸制皂系統(tǒng)(下)
小議PLC與單片機(jī)之間的串行通信及應(yīng)用
電子制作(2018年12期)2018-08-01 00:48:04
連通與提升系統(tǒng)的最后一塊拼圖 Audiolab 傲立 M-DAC mini
主站蜘蛛池模板: 色综合综合网| 青青操视频免费观看| 91精品国产自产91精品资源| 国产精品9| 999国内精品久久免费视频| 亚洲成人网在线观看| 成人另类稀缺在线观看| 91视频精品| jizz在线免费播放| 国产欧美视频在线观看| 男人的天堂久久精品激情| 免费a级毛片视频| 香蕉精品在线| 欧美性色综合网| 天天色天天综合| 黄色a一级视频| 五月婷婷激情四射| 免费观看精品视频999| 国产视频只有无码精品| 在线欧美日韩| 亚洲精品第一页不卡| 71pao成人国产永久免费视频| 黄色一及毛片| 国产成人久久777777| 69av在线| 国产高潮流白浆视频| 国产亚洲高清视频| 免费国产不卡午夜福在线观看| 亚洲色图欧美视频| 亚洲精品福利视频| 免费人成在线观看成人片| 蜜芽一区二区国产精品| 国产精品99r8在线观看| 国产乱人伦偷精品视频AAA| 亚洲欧美日本国产综合在线 | 欧美成人一级| 日韩精品毛片| 三上悠亚一区二区| 女人18毛片久久| 孕妇高潮太爽了在线观看免费| 中国精品久久| av性天堂网| 青青青草国产| 67194亚洲无码| 日本国产一区在线观看| 久青草免费在线视频| 色综合网址| 成·人免费午夜无码视频在线观看 | 91久久精品日日躁夜夜躁欧美| 欧美国产精品不卡在线观看| 久久精品丝袜| 国产精品视频系列专区| 亚洲中文字幕国产av| 久久激情影院| 波多野结衣第一页| 亚洲青涩在线| 日日碰狠狠添天天爽| 欧美69视频在线| 美女被操黄色视频网站| 国产三级精品三级在线观看| 国产精品黄色片| 又污又黄又无遮挡网站| 国产亚洲视频播放9000| 久久性视频| 亚洲综合久久一本伊一区| 欧美伦理一区| 国内精品自在自线视频香蕉| 9啪在线视频| 99视频免费观看| 国产欧美日韩在线一区| 国产精品区视频中文字幕| 国产精品久久久久久久久久98 | 夜精品a一区二区三区| 日韩激情成人| 国产永久在线观看| av色爱 天堂网| 精品久久国产综合精麻豆| 黄色网页在线观看| 精品久久国产综合精麻豆| 亚洲人成网站在线观看播放不卡| 亚洲系列无码专区偷窥无码| 国产av剧情无码精品色午夜|